Compass Associates are delighted to be working with a leading independent healthcare facility in their search for a Clinical Pharmacist for their Pharmacy site based in central London. The centre is renowned in the healthcare sector for its commitment to an outstanding level of care and support across the many specialities it covers, including Men’s & Women’s Health, Surgery, Digestive Health as well as a fully maintained diagnostic suite. They are currently searching for a Clinical Pharmacist with post-registration experience to oversee the pharmacy with their brand new evening service, providing their pharmaceutical knowledge and experience in ensuring the care of the patients at the centre. You will be responsible for supervising the procurement, preparation, dispensation & distribution of medicines to patients while providing standard of care through the medical management service. You will be ensuring the pharmacy department operates in a timely and consistent manner whilst overseeing the general running of the service, providing clinical input where necessary.
